After completing 18 full years, you go to 16 hours per month and that is the cap for earning. … Splet01. jun. 2024 · Yes, you can cap the number of PTO days an employee can earn. In states that forbid “use it or lose it” vacation policies, you can do so by stopping the accrual of PTO when it hits a cap or limit, and then restarting accrual once an employee uses some of it.

Remember that Jane only works part-time, so her allowance needs to be prorated by dividing the number of hours … SpletTime off that an employee has earned over a given amount of time, typically over a certain number of hours, days, weeks, or months worked. Example: An employee earns one hour of paid time off for every 20 hours worked. After working 400 hours, the employee has 20 hours of accrued time off. Annual Allotment: scooter elaborati
